The painting titled "Village in Winter" depicts a serene rural scene blanketed in snow, capturing the quiet beauty of a village during the cold season. The artist uses a palette knife technique to apply thick layers of oil paint, creating a textured, almost three-dimensional surface that enhances the depth and atmosphere of the composition. The color palette, dominated by cool tones of blue, violet, and white, contrasts beautifully with the warm accents of brown, orange, and yellow, bringing life and warmth to the cold winter landscape. The foreground shows a snow-covered field, painted in soft shades of white, lavender, and pale blue. The textured brushstrokes suggest the uneven surface of the snow, with subtle shadows and reflections adding depth and realism. Scattered across the field are yellow and orange stalks of dried grass, poking through the snow, symbolizing the resilience of nature even in harsh conditions. These bright accents bring warmth and energy to the otherwise cool color scheme. The thick, layered application of paint in the foreground conveys the tactile sensation of fresh snow, emphasizing the quiet, untouched beauty of a winter landscape. The middle ground features a row of traditional village houses, their rooftops covered in snow. The houses are painted in muted tones of blue, brown, and white, blending harmoniously with the surrounding landscape. The snow-covered roofs add a sense of coziness and shelter, evoking the warmth of life inside, despite the cold weather outside. Behind the houses, a line of trees painted in deep greens and browns creates a natural boundary between the village and the horizon. The trees, with their bare branches, stand as silent witnesses to the changing seasons, adding a touch of melancholy and tranquility to the scene. Several wooden poles are visible throughout the composition, likely supporting electrical lines, hinting at the presence of human life and modernity in this otherwise timeless rural setting. The background is filled with a soft, cloudy sky, painted in shades of beige, pale pink, and light gray. The sky appears hazy, suggesting a calm winter day, with the sun hidden behind the clouds. The muted colors in the sky create a sense of stillness and quiet, reinforcing the peaceful atmosphere of the village. The combination of warm and cool tones in the background creates a sense of balance, making the composition feel harmonious and complete. The blurred edges of the horizon suggest a gentle transition between the village and the sky, emphasizing the vastness of the winter landscape. "Village in Winter" is a captivating portrayal of a snowy rural landscape, capturing both the beauty and tranquility of winter. The thick textures and harmonious color palette bring depth and life to the scene, while the quiet atmosphere evokes feelings of peace and reflection. The painting invites the viewer to experience the timeless charm of village life during winter, appreciating the simple, enduring beauty of nature in all its forms.

About the artist: Ivanyuk Oksana was born in 1964 in Rivne region. The love of painting has taken over from the baby. From 1975 to 1980 she studied at the Zoryan Art School of Rivne region.
In 1985 she graduated from the Crimean Art College. M. Samokish (now has the status of a national university). Her teachers of painting were G. Kurilenko, V. Grigoriev. After graduating from the school, she began to work as a teacher of fine arts at the Piryatin School - a gymnasium of aesthetic education, which she founded with her husband in 1990.
Ivanyuk Oksana works in the landscape and still life genre. Personal exhibitions: Kyiv, Museum of Ukrainian Heritage; T. Shevchenko National Museum; the diplomatic mission of Ukraine to the USA (California) and others. She has participated in numerous exhibitions both in Ukraine and abroad.
